Question
Find the least number which must be subtracted from the following number so as to get a perfect square. Also find the square root of the perfect square so obtained.
3250

Solution
The square root of 3250 can be calculated by long division method as follows:
| 57 | |
| 5 | `bar32 bar50` -25 |
| 107 | 750 -749 |
| 1 |
The remainder is 1. It represents that the square of 57 is less than 3250 by 1. Therefore, a perfect square can be obtained by subtracting 1 from the given number 3250.
Therefore, required perfect square = 3250 − 1 = 3249
And `sqrt(3249)` = 57
